Impact of Green Budgeting on Capital Expenditure Classification

High

With India's increasing focus on climate action and sustainable development, 'green budgeting' is gaining prominence. This angle would explore how expenditures related to renewable energy, electric vehicles, sustainable infrastructure, and climate resilience are classified (often as capital expenditure) and their implications for achieving environmental targets and economic growth. UPSC could ask about specific green initiatives in Budget 2024-25 and their classification, or the challenges of integrating environmental goals into traditional expenditure frameworks.

Capital Expenditure Multiplier Effect and its Role in Post-Pandemic Economic Recovery

Medium to High

The government has consistently emphasized capital expenditure as a key driver for economic recovery and growth post-pandemic. This angle would focus on the theoretical concept of the multiplier effect, its empirical relevance in India, and how increased capital outlay (e.g., PM Gati Shakti, infrastructure projects) is expected to stimulate demand, create jobs, and 'crowd in' private investment. Questions could involve analyzing the effectiveness of this strategy and comparing it with other fiscal stimuli.

Interplay between Electoral Cycles and Revenue vs. Capital Expenditure Patterns

Medium

This angle delves into the political economy of public finance. It would examine whether governments tend to increase revenue expenditure (e.g., subsidies, welfare schemes) closer to elections to gain popular support, potentially at the expense of long-term capital investments. While recent budgets show a sustained capital push, the underlying political pressures and their impact on expenditure choices remain a relevant analytical point for UPSC, especially in the context of fiscal prudence and populist measures.
